The book gives the impact of the photoluminescence and study of rare earth doped phosphors for fluorescent lamps, TV tubes, electroluminescent display devices, high quality image intensifiers and SSL (Solid State Lightening), LED (Light Emitting Diode).

Vikas Dubey completed his PhD from the National Institute of Technology Raipur, Chhattisgarh, India in 2015. He has published more than 100 articles in SCI journals, 5 books published internationally, one book chapter in a Springer Journal, as well as one edited book with IGI global. He is an editorial board member of 3 journals including one Elsevier publication. He has completed two minor research project funded by CCOST. He has also received the young scientist award from Chhattisgarh state. Sudipta Som completed his PhD from ISM Dhanbad. After that he successfully completed his Post-Doc from University of Free State South Africa. Presently he is working on MOST fellowship at the National Taiwan University Taipei. He has published more than 50 articles in SCI journals. He has also published one book internationally. Vijay Kumar is an Assistant Professor at Chandigarh University, Gharuan, Mohali, India. He was a postdoc fellow in Professor Swart's group at the University of the Free State, South Africa from April 2013-December 2015. During the last eight years of his research career, he has published a significant number of publications to his credit on diverse topics/areas. So far, he has published more than 70 research papers in many of the reputed international journals, which attracted more than 1630 citations with an h-index of 23. He has edited 02 books for Springer and Wiley respectively and one is in the final stages of publication with Springer. He is a reviewer for about 40 international and national professional journals in his field (or in related fields). He is a member of the editorial board of few journals. He is a lead guest editor of Virtual Special Issue of VACUUM (Elsevier Journal, I.F. = 1.53) and Materials Today : Proceedings which will publish the proceedings of ISFM-2018. He has received "Teacher with Best Research Contribution Award" by Hon'ble Chancellor, Chandigarh University on Teachers Day. He has received the Young Scientist Award under the fast track scheme of Department of Science and Technology (Ministry of Science and Technology, Government of India), New Delhi. He has also received an Indo - US R&D Joint Networked Center Research Project grant from The Indo-US Science and Technology Forum (IUSSTF) in collaboration with Harvard-MIT Division of Health Sciences and Technology,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T), USA; Texas A&M University, USA and Indian Institute of Technology Kanpur. He has been nominated as a member of the Scientific Advisory Committee for Initiative for Research and Innovation in Science (IRIS) by DST for 03 years (2017-2020). He is also serving as the Conference Chairs/ Convener of International Symposium on Functional Materials (ISFM-2018): Energy and Biomedical Applications.
1. Tb3+ Activated High-color-rendering Green Light Yttrium
Oxyorthosilicates Phosphors for Display Device Application. 2. Versatile
Applications of Rare-Earth Activated Phosphate Phosphors: A Review. 3.
Photoluminescence Mechanism and Key Factors to Improve Intensity of
Lanthanide Doped Tungstates/Molybdates Phosphor with Their Applications. 4.
Down Converted Photoluminescence of Trivalent Rare-Earth Activated Glasses
for Lighting Applications. 5. Effect of CaZrO3 Doping by Gd3+ on
Phototherapy Lamp Phosphor Performance. 6. Investigations on Tunable Blue
Light Emitting P-Acetyl Biphenyl-DPQ Phosphor for OLED Applications. 7.
Phosphors in Role of Magnetic Resonance, Medical Imaging and Drug Delivery
Applications: A Review. 8. Visible Light Emitting Ln3+ Ions (Ln= Eu, Sm,
Tb, Dy) in Mg2SiO4 Host Lattice. 9. Synthesis and Luminescence
Characteristics of Europium Doped Gadolinium Based Oxide Phosphors for
Display and Lighting Applications. 10. Comparative Study on Synthesis of
Gd2O3: Eu Phosphors by Various Synthesis Routes. 11. Significance of TL
Radiation Dosimetry of Carbon Ion Beam in Radiotherapy. 12. Upconversion
Photoluminescence in the Rare Earth Doped Y2O3 Phosphor Materials. 13.
Synthesis and Potential Application of Rare Earth Doped Fluoride Based Host
Matrices. 14. Preparation of Thin Films using Electron Beam Evaporation
Deposition Method.
